A compact, right-slanted sans with sturdy, low-contrast strokes and rounded curves that stay smooth through joins and terminals. Proportions are tight and efficient, with relatively small counters and a forward-leaning rhythm that keeps lines feeling fast and continuous. The uppercase is assertive and uniform, while the lowercase follows the same oblique structure with simple, single-storey-style forms where applicable and minimal detailing. Numerals match the overall momentum, using broad curves and sturdy diagonals for a cohesive, high-impact texture.
Works best in short-to-medium display settings where speed and impact matter, such as headlines, posters, sports or automotive-adjacent branding, and attention-grabbing packaging. It can also serve in interface or signage contexts when a compact, emphatic italic look is desired, especially for labels, calls-to-action, or emphasis lines.
The overall tone is energetic and driven, with a forward-leaning stance that reads as active and purposeful. Its compact shapes and heavy presence create a confident, no-nonsense voice that feels contemporary and performance-oriented.
The design appears intended to deliver a strong, modern italic sans that reads quickly and projects motion. Its compact build and smooth geometry suggest a focus on bold presence and clear shapes rather than typographic ornament or fine detail.
The italic angle is consistent across cases, and the design relies on clean geometric curves and strong diagonals rather than decorative features. Spacing appears tuned for a dense, punchy color in text, making the face feel bold in voice even at moderate sizes.
